The best time to visit Scandinavia is in summer. Since winters can be quite harsh, summers are your best bet.

Kerala experiences a heavy monsoon and extremely humid summers. That's why the best time to visit Kerala is considered the winter season, between September and March. During these months, the weather is pleasantly cool and ideal to enjoy the outdoors.

The Schengen visa is a short-stay visa which allows you to travel to any of the Schengen areas for as long as 90 days. If you have a Schengen visa, you can travel freely within any of the Schengen member countries.

You can find Kerala tour packages of varying lengths and each of them offer plenty of scenic beauty and thrilling activity. Thomas Cook Kerala packages range from quick 3 night - 4 day stays to, long 7-night 8-day holidays.

Indian citizens must apply for an Electronic Travel Authorization (ETA) visa online through a web-based visa system. Please access the following link for more details: www.eta.gov.lk

No. To be able to drive around in Sri Lanka, Indian tourists will have to obtain an International Drivers Permit (IDP). Through this IDP, they can apply for a Sri Lankan Temporary Driving Permit at any local RTO office in Sri Lanka.

Traveling to some parts of Ladakh that lie close to the borders of China and Tibet does require a permit. So, you must do proper research of the particular place before visiting it when on a Jammu & Kashmir trip.


Yes, traveling to Jammu and Kashmir is absolutely safe. However, don’t be shocked by the abundance of military checkpoints, tanks on the side of the road, military trucks, and heavy-armed soldiers roaming down the streets. You can absolutely enjoy your Jammu & Kashmir trip worry-free.
